    What I ended up doing was to tie the black and green together and connect the red and white to the switch (front pup only). That way the current was reversed and the correct coil was engaged with no hum in the middle switch pos with no loss of output.

    with jackson pups you still need to wire red and white together, wire the braided unsheilded wire and black to ground, and green to hot. switch green and black to change the polarity.
